The Chinese company Haier is expanding its cooperation with SmartFactoryKL and announced the opening of a research office in Kaiserslautern in a ceremony at Hannover Messe.
Prof. Dr. Detlef Zühlke, Chairman of the Board of SmartFactoryKL, and Chen Lucheng, Vice President Haier Home Appliance Industry Group, unveiled a name plate at Hannover Messe to celebrate the opening of a Haier research office in Kaiserslautern. At least two employees will soon begin their work in the research office, supported by students from Kaiserslautern Technical University, Zühlke said to the regional newspaper DIE RHEINPFALZ.
Haier is aiming to expand its research activities in Germany within the initiative COSMOPlat. It got to know the academic city of Kaiserslautern – thanks to the support of the government of Rhineland-Palatinate – as a promising location. The Haier delegation also visited the German Research Center for Artificial Intelligence and John Deere’s Research Center ETIC in Kaiserslautern. Afterwards, the delegation was greeted by Rhineland-Palatinate’s Minister for Economic Affairs Dr. Volker Wissing in Mainz.
